Technical Specifications

Parameter NameValue
TypeParameter
Mounting Type Surface Mount
Package / Case 40-VFQFN Exposed Pad
Supplier Device Package 40-QFN (6x6)
Operating Temperature0°C~70°C
PackagingTray
Series PRoC®
Part StatusObsolete
Moisture Sensitivity Level (MSL) 3 (168 Hours)
Type TxRx + MCU
Voltage - Supply 1.8V~3.6V
Frequency 2.4GHz
Memory Size8kB Flash 256B SRAM
Power - Output 4dBm
RF Family/Standard General ISM > 1GHZ
Sensitivity -97dBm
Data Rate (Max) 1Mbps
Serial InterfacesSPI
Current - Receiving 18.9mA~21.9mA
Current - Transmitting 21.2mA~39.9mA
Modulation DSSS, GFSK
GPIO 15
